Belišće is a charming town located in eastern Croatia, nestled along the banks of the Drava River. Known for its rich industrial heritage, it offers a unique mix of history and natural beauty. The town is surrounded by lush forests and scenic landscapes, making it an ideal destination for outdoor enthusiasts.
Belišće's warm and welcoming atmosphere provides an authentic experience of Croatian culture and hospitality.

Located approximately 20 km from Belišće, Osijek Airport serves domestic and limited international flights, making it the nearest airport for travelers.
